Our pick of the weekend’s action:

To send a link to this page to a friend, you must be logged in.

FRIDAY 22

Examine an animation developed through an ever-evolving painting on the window of 36 Junction Road by artist Eleanor Meredith as part of a long-term exhibition. All day at the A Million Minutes Shop Studio, Junction Road, N19. Free, call 020 7514 2366.

Keep your fingers crossed for spring at this Nordic walking session for over-55s, from 2pm, at the Drovers Centre, North Road, N7. Costs £2, call 07900 888438.

Enjoy some time with chaps of an excellent vintage at Friday Fellas, from 11.30am to 4pm, at Sotheby Mews Day Centre, Sotheby Mews, N5. Costs £3.50 (including lunch and an exercise class). Call 020 7226 1421.

SATURDAY 23

Make like Jake and Elwood with a night of live music courtesy of the Bluespective Band, from 9 to 11.30pm at Ajani Grill, Hornsey Road, N19. Costs £6, call 020 7272 5566.

Get your skank on with an evening of Ska, reggae and dub from Selecter, Zion Train and Talisman, from 7pm at Islington Assembly Hall, Upper Street, N1. Tickets from £19.50, visit agmp.ticketabc.com.

Enjoy the music of French House Legend Alan Braxe – part of the team behind Music Sounds Better With You – as this famous venue celebrates it’s fourth birthday, from 8pm to 4am at the Queen of Hoxton, Curtain Road, EC2. Costs £8, call 0207 422 0958.

SUNDAY 24

Find out more about romantic composer Johannes Brahms with exclusive access to an London Symphony Orchestra (LSO) rehearsal followed by a lecture and a one-off performance of Brahms’ String Sextet by LSO string players, from 10am to 5.30pm at LSO St Luke’s, Central Street, EC1. Costs £17, email Emma.Lewis@lso.co.uk.

Participate in a family workshop with a laboratory feel investigating, making artworks from trivial everyday materials, from 2.30 to 4.30pm at Parasol Unit Foundation for Contemporary Art, Wharf Road, N1. Costs £5 per family, call 0207 490 7373.

Stay incredibly strong at chi kung self-defence classes, every Sunday, from 11am to noon, at Providence Court, Upper Street, N1, on Saturdays from 11.15am to 12.30pm and on Fridays from 6.45pm to 7.45pm, at the Unity Church, Upper Street, N1. Call 07973 622240. Classes costs £10 per lesson or £40 for five.
